not with a standard scantool that an auto elec would have.
choosing n/a option would have absolutly no effect, besides not been able to view data to do with supercharger.

it means that on the black chip in the blue memcal, there is a silver sticker. remove the sticker and youll see a round window. expose that window to UV light, usually with a UV chip eraser, and you can remove the tune off it and burn a new one on
